Double-Digit Growth Looms in AMOLED Encapsulation Materials, Says IHS Markit

The global market for encapsulation materials used in active-matrix OLED displays is expected to rise 76 percent this year from last, to $111 million, said Richard Son, IHS Markit principal analyst-display chemical materials, in a Monday research note. Son sees…

a bright long-term outlook for the encapsulation materials market as AMOLED displays are expected to double their share of the overall display market to 22 percent in 2020, from 11 percent this year he said. AMOLED encapsulation surface area is expected to rise 62 percent year over year to reach 4 million square meters in 2016, he said: “Double-digit growth will continue, reaching 13 million square meters in 2020.” Of the three types of encapsulation materials -- glass, metal and thin-film -- used in AMOLED displays, Son sees glass getting 56 percent of the total encapsulation market this year, he said. “However, with rising demand for AMOLED TVs requiring much larger display surface area than smaller smartphone and wearable devices, metal encapsulation is expected to overtake glass encapsulation, to reach 53 percent of the market in 2017,” he said.
